Vent pipe installation involves setting up the vertical pipes that allow gases, odors, and moisture from plumbing systems to safely escape from a property. These pipes are typically installed through the roof or exterior walls and are designed to vent plumbing fixtures such as sinks, toilets, and laundry machines. Proper installation ensures that sewer gases do not accumulate inside the building and that plumbing systems function efficiently. Experienced service providers can assess the specific needs of a property and install vent pipes that meet local building codes and standards, helping to maintain a safe and functional plumbing system.
One common reason property owners seek vent pipe installation is to address issues caused by improper or outdated venting. When vent pipes are blocked, damaged, or incorrectly installed, it can lead to slow drains, gurgling sounds, or foul odors inside the home. In some cases, inadequate venting may cause sewer gases to seep into living spaces, creating health and safety concerns. Local contractors can evaluate existing vent systems and recommend the appropriate installation or repair work to resolve these problems, ensuring that plumbing functions smoothly and odors are effectively vented outside.

The overview below groups typical Vent Pipe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Livermore,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ine vent pipe repairs in Livermore, CA, range from $250 to $600. Most minor fixes fall within this band, making it a common price point for many local service providers.
Partial Replacements - Replacing a section of a vent pipe generally costs between $600 and $1,200, depending on the pipe length and accessibility. Many projects in this range are standard replacements that local contractors handle regularly.
Full Replacement - Complete vent pipe replacements usually fall between $1,200 and $3,000,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her amounts. Fewer projects push into this tier, but they are necessary for extensive or outdated vent systems.
Custom or Complex Installations - Larger, more intricate vent pipe installations can exceed $3,000, with some complex projects reaching $5,000 or more. Such jobs are less common and typically involve additional structural considerations or custom work by local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vent pipe and why is it important? A vent pipe allows gases and odors from plumbing systems to escape safely outside, helping to prevent sewer gases from entering the building and ensuring proper drainage.
How do local contractors install vent pipes in a home? Contractors typically assess the plumbing layout, select appropriate pipe materials, and carefully route the vent pipe through the roof or exterior wall to ensure proper ventilation and code compliance.
What types of vent pipes are commonly used in residential installations? Common options include PVC, ABS, and metal pipes, each chosen based on the building’s requirements, local codes, and the specific application.
Are there different vent pipe installation methods for new construction versus renovations? Yes, new construction often involves integrating vent pipes during framing, while renovations may require modifying existing plumbing to add or replace vent pipes.
What signs indicate that vent pipe repairs or replacements might be needed?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ling noises in plumbing, foul odors, or visible damage to the vent pipe system, prompting a professional assessment by local contractors.
